//go:generate stringer -type=PacketType
package pktfwd
import (
"encoding/binary"
"encoding/json"
"errors"
"strconv"
"strings"
"time"
"github.com/brocaar/lorawan"
)
// PacketType defines the packet type.
type PacketType byte
// Available packet types
const (
PushData PacketType = iota
PushACK
PullData
PullResp
PullACK
TXACK
)
// Protocol versions
const (
ProtocolVersion1 uint8 = 0x01
ProtocolVersion2 uint8 = 0x02
)
// Errors
var (
ErrInvalidProtocolVersion = errors.New("gateway: invalid protocol version")
)
func protocolSupported(p uint8) bool {
if p == ProtocolVersion1 || p == ProtocolVersion2 {
return true
}
return false
}
// PushDataPacket type is used by the gateway mainly to forward the RF packets
// received, and associated metadata, to the server.
type PushDataPacket struct {
ProtocolVersion uint8
RandomToken uint16
GatewayMAC lorawan.EUI64
Payload PushDataPayload
}
// MarshalBinary marshals the object in binary form.
func (p PushDataPacket) MarshalBinary() ([]byte, error) {
pb, err := json.Marshal(&p.Payload)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
out := make([]byte, 4, len(pb)+12)
out[0] = p.ProtocolVersion
binary.LittleEndian.PutUint16(out[1:3], p.RandomToken)
out[3] = byte(PushData)
out = append(out, p.GatewayMAC[0:len(p.GatewayMAC)]...)
out = append(out, pb...)
return out, nil
}
// UnmarshalBinary decodes the object from binary form.
func (p *PushDataPacket) UnmarshalBinary(data []byte) error {
if len(data) < 13 {
return errors.New("gateway: at least 13 bytes are expected")
}
if data[3] != byte(PushData) {
return errors.New("gateway: identifier mismatch (PUSH_DATA expected)")
}
if !protocolSupported(data[0]) {
return ErrInvalidProtocolVersion
}
p.ProtocolVersion = data[0]
p.RandomToken = binary.LittleEndian.Uint16(data[1:3])
for i := 0; i < 8; i++ {
p.GatewayMAC[i] = data[4+i]
}
return json.Unmarshal(data[12:], &p.Payload)
}
// PushACKPacket is used by the server to acknowledge immediately all the
// PUSH_DATA packets received.
type PushACKPacket struct {
ProtocolVersion uint8
RandomToken uint16
}
// MarshalBinary marshals the object in binary form.
func (p PushACKPacket) MarshalBinary() ([]byte, error) {
out := make([]byte, 4)
out[0] = p.ProtocolVersion
binary.LittleEndian.PutUint16(out[1:3], p.RandomToken)
out[3] = byte(PushACK)
return out, nil
}
// UnmarshalBinary decodes the object from binary form.
func (p *PushACKPacket) UnmarshalBinary(data []byte) error {
if len(data) != 4 {
return errors.New("gateway: 4 bytes of data are expected")
}
if data[3] != byte(PushACK) {
return errors.New("gateway: identifier mismatch (PUSH_ACK expected)")
}
if !protocolSupported(data[0]) {
return ErrInvalidProtocolVersion
}
p.ProtocolVersion = data[0]
p.RandomToken = binary.LittleEndian.Uint16(data[1:3])
return nil
}
// PullDataPacket is used by the gateway to poll data from the server.
type PullDataPacket struct {
ProtocolVersion uint8
RandomToken uint16
GatewayMAC lorawan.EUI64
}
// MarshalBinary marshals the object in binary form.
func (p PullDataPacket) MarshalBinary() ([]byte, error) {
out := make([]byte, 4, 12)
out[0] = p.ProtocolVersion
binary.LittleEndian.PutUint16(out[1:3], p.RandomToken)
out[3] = byte(PullData)
out = append(out, p.GatewayMAC[0:len(p.GatewayMAC)]...)
return out, nil
}
// UnmarshalBinary decodes the object from binary form.
func (p *PullDataPacket) UnmarshalBinary(data []byte) error {
if len(data) != 12 {
return errors.New("gateway: 12 bytes of data are expected")
}
if data[3] != byte(PullData) {
return errors.New("gateway: identifier mismatch (PULL_DATA expected)")
}
if !protocolSupported(data[0]) {
return ErrInvalidProtocolVersion
}
p.ProtocolVersion = data[0]
p.RandomToken = binary.LittleEndian.Uint16(data[1:3])
for i := 0; i < 8; i++ {
p.GatewayMAC[i] = data[4+i]
}
return nil
}
// PullACKPacket is used by the server to confirm that the network route is
// open and that the server can send PULL_RESP packets at any time.
type PullACKPacket struct {
ProtocolVersion uint8
RandomToken uint16
}
// MarshalBinary marshals the object in binary form.
func (p PullACKPacket) MarshalBinary() ([]byte, error) {
out := make([]byte, 4)
out[0] = p.ProtocolVersion
binary.LittleEndian.PutUint16(out[1:3], p.RandomToken)
out[3] = byte(PullACK)
return out, nil
}
// UnmarshalBinary decodes the object from binary form.
func (p *PullACKPacket) UnmarshalBinary(data []byte) error {
if len(data) != 4 {
return errors.New("gateway: 4 bytes of data are expected")
}
if data[3] != byte(PullACK) {
return errors.New("gateway: identifier mismatch (PULL_ACK expected)")
}
if !protocolSupported(data[0]) {
return ErrInvalidProtocolVersion
}
p.ProtocolVersion = data[0]
p.RandomToken = binary.LittleEndian.Uint16(data[1:3])
return nil
}
// PullRespPacket is used by the server to send RF packets and associated
// metadata that will have to be emitted by the gateway.
type PullRespPacket struct {
ProtocolVersion uint8
RandomToken uint16
Payload PullRespPayload
}
// MarshalBinary marshals the object in binary form.
func (p PullRespPacket) MarshalBinary() ([]byte, error) {
pb, err := json.Marshal(&p.Payload)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
out := make([]byte, 4, 4+len(pb))
out[0] = p.ProtocolVersion
if p.ProtocolVersion != ProtocolVersion1 {
// these two bytes are unused in ProtocolVersion1
binary.LittleEndian.PutUint16(out[1:3], p.RandomToken)
}
out[3] = byte(PullResp)
out = append(out, pb...)
return out, nil
}
// UnmarshalBinary decodes the object from binary form.
func (p *PullRespPacket) UnmarshalBinary(data []byte) error {
if len(data) < 5 {
return errors.New("gateway: at least 5 bytes of data are expected")
}
if data[3] != byte(PullResp) {
return errors.New("gateway: identifier mismatch (PULL_RESP expected)")
}
if !protocolSupported(data[0]) {
return ErrInvalidProtocolVersion
}
p.ProtocolVersion = data[0]
p.RandomToken = binary.LittleEndian.Uint16(data[1:3])
return json.Unmarshal(data[4:], &p.Payload)
}
// TXACKPacket is used by the gateway to send a feedback to the server
// to inform if a downlink request has been accepted or rejected by the
// gateway.
type TXACKPacket struct {
ProtocolVersion uint8
RandomToken uint16
GatewayMAC lorawan.EUI64
Payload *TXACKPayload
}
// MarshalBinary marshals the object into binary form.
func (p TXACKPacket) MarshalBinary() ([]byte, error) {
var pb []byte
if p.Payload != nil {
var err error
pb, err = json.Marshal(p.Payload)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
}
out := make([]byte, 4, len(pb)+12)
out[0] = p.ProtocolVersion
binary.LittleEndian.PutUint16(out[1:3], p.RandomToken)
out[3] = byte(TXACK)
out = append(out, p.GatewayMAC[:]...)
out = append(out, pb...)
return out, nil
}
// UnmarshalBinary decodes the object from binary form.
func (p *TXACKPacket) UnmarshalBinary(data []byte) error {
if len(data) < 12 {
return errors.New("gateway: at least 12 bytes of data are expected")
}
if data[3] != byte(TXACK) {
return errors.New("gateway: identifier mismatch (TXACK expected)")
}
if !protocolSupported(data[0]) {
return ErrInvalidProtocolVersion
}
p.ProtocolVersion = data[0]
p.RandomToken = binary.LittleEndian.Uint16(data[1:3])
for i := 0; i < 8; i++ {
p.GatewayMAC[i] = data[4+i]
}
if len(data) > 12 {
p.Payload = &TXACKPayload{}
return json.Unmarshal(data[12:], p.Payload)
}
return nil
}
// TXACKPayload contains the TXACKPacket payload.
type TXACKPayload struct {
TXPKACK TXPKACK `json:"txpk_ack"`
}
// TXPKACK contains the status information of the associated PULL_RESP
// packet.
type TXPKACK struct {
Error string `json:"error"`
}
// PushDataPayload represents the upstream JSON data structure.
type PushDataPayload struct {
RXPK []RXPK `json:"rxpk,omitempty"`
Stat *Stat `json:"stat,omitempty"`
}
// PullRespPayload represents the downstream JSON data structure.
type PullRespPayload struct {
TXPK TXPK `json:"txpk"`
}
// CompactTime implements time.Time but (un)marshals to and from
// ISO 8601 'compact' format.
type CompactTime time.Time
// MarshalJSON implements the json.Marshaler interface.
func (t CompactTime) MarshalJSON() ([]byte, error) {
return []byte(time.Time(t).UTC().Format(`"` + time.RFC3339Nano + `"`)), nil
}
// UnmarshalJSON implements the json.Unmarshaler interface.
func (t *CompactTime) UnmarshalJSON(data []byte) error {
t2, err := time.Parse(`"`+time.RFC3339Nano+`"`, string(data))
if err != nil {
return err
}
*t = CompactTime(t2)
return nil
}
// ExpandedTime implements time.Time but (un)marshals to and from
// ISO 8601 'expanded' format.
type ExpandedTime time.Time
// MarshalJSON implements the json.Marshaler interface.
func (t ExpandedTime) MarshalJSON() ([]byte, error) {
return []byte(time.Time(t).UTC().Format(`"2006-01-02 15:04:05 MST"`)), nil
}
// UnmarshalJSON implements the json.Unmarshaler interface.
func (t *ExpandedTime) UnmarshalJSON(data []byte) error {
t2, err := time.Parse(`"2006-01-02 15:04:05 MST"`, string(data))
if err != nil {
return err
}
*t = ExpandedTime(t2)
return nil
}
// DatR implements the data rate which can be either a string (LoRa identifier)
// or an unsigned integer in case of FSK (bits per second).
type DatR struct {
LoRa string
FSK uint32
}
// MarshalJSON implements the json.Marshaler interface.
func (d DatR) MarshalJSON() ([]byte, error) {
if d.LoRa != "" {
return []byte(`"` + d.LoRa + `"`), nil
}
return []byte(strconv.FormatUint(uint64(d.FSK), 10)), nil
}
// UnmarshalJSON implements the json.Unmarshaler interface.
func (d *DatR) UnmarshalJSON(data []byte) error {
i, err := strconv.ParseUint(string(data), 10, 32)
if err != nil {
d.LoRa = strings.Trim(string(data), `"`)
return nil
}
d.FSK = uint32(i)
return nil
}
// RXPK contain a RF packet and associated metadata.
type RXPK struct {
Time CompactTime `json:"time"` // UTC time of pkt RX, us precision, ISO 8601 'compact' format (e.g. 2013-03-31T16:21:17.528002Z)
Tmst uint32 `json:"tmst"` // Internal timestamp of "RX finished" event (32b unsigned)
Freq float64 `json:"freq"` // RX central frequency in MHz (unsigned float, Hz precision)
Chan uint8 `json:"chan"` // Concentrator "IF" channel used for RX (unsigned integer)
RFCh uint8 `json:"rfch"` // Concentrator "RF chain" used for RX (unsigned integer)
Stat int8 `json:"stat"` // CRC status: 1 = OK, -1 = fail, 0 = no CRC
Modu string `json:"modu"` // Modulation identifier "LORA" or "FSK"
DatR DatR `json:"datr"` // LoRa datarate identifier (eg. SF12BW500) || FSK datarate (unsigned, in bits per second)
CodR string `json:"codr"` // LoRa ECC coding rate identifier
RSSI int16 `json:"rssi"` // RSSI in dBm (signed integer, 1 dB precision)
LSNR float64 `json:"lsnr"` // Lora SNR ratio in dB (signed float, 0.1 dB precision)
Size uint16 `json:"size"` // RF packet payload size in bytes (unsigned integer)
Data string `json:"data"` // Base64 encoded RF packet payload, padded
RSig []RSig `json:"rsig"` // Received signal information, per antenna (Optional)
}
// RSig contains the metadata associated with the received signal
type RSig struct {
Ant uint8 `json:"ant"` // Antenna number on which signal has been received
Chan uint8 `json:"chan"` // Concentrator "IF" channel used for RX (unsigned integer)
RSSIC int16 `json:"rssic"` // RSSI in dBm of the channel (signed integer, 1 dB precision)
RSSIS int16 `json:"rssis"` // RSSI in dBm of the signal (signed integer, 1 DB precision) (Optional)
RSSISD uint16 `json:"rssisd"` // Standard deviation of RSSI during preamble (unsigned integer) (Optional)
LSNR float64 `json:"lsnr"` // Lora SNR ratio in dB (signed float, 0.1 dB precision)
ETime string `json:"etime"` // Encrypted timestamp, ns precision [0..999999999] (Optional)
FTime int64 `json:"ftime"` // Fine timestamp, ns precision [0..999999999] (Optional)
FOff int32 `json:"foff"` // Frequency offset in Hz [-125kHz..+125Khz] (Optional)
}
// Stat contains the status of the gateway.
type Stat struct {
Time ExpandedTime `json:"time"` // UTC 'system' time of the gateway, ISO 8601 'expanded' format (e.g 2014-01-12 08:59:28 GMT)
Boot ExpandedTime `json:"boot"` // UTC 'boot' time of the gateway, ISO 8601 'expanded' format (e.g 2014-01-12 08:59:28 GMT)
Lati float64 `json:"lati"` // GPS latitude of the gateway in degree (float, N is +)
Long float64 `json:"long"` // GPS latitude of the gateway in degree (float, E is +)
Alti int32 `json:"alti"` // GPS altitude of the gateway in meter RX (integer)
RXNb uint32 `json:"rxnb"` // Number of radio packets received (unsigned integer)
RXOK uint32 `json:"rxok"` // Number of radio packets received with a valid PHY CRC
RXFW uint32 `json:"rxfw"` // Number of radio packets forwarded (unsigned integer)
ACKR float64 `json:"ackr"` // Percentage of upstream datagrams that were acknowledged
DWNb uint32 `json:"dwnb"` // Number of downlink datagrams received (unsigned integer)
TXNb uint32 `json:"txnb"` // Number of packets emitted (unsigned integer)
LMOK uint32 `json:"lmok"` // Number of packets received from link testing mote, with CRC OK (unsigned inteter)
LMST uint32 `json:"lmst"` // Sequence number of the first packet received from link testing mote (unsigned integer)
LMNW uint32 `json:"lmnw"` // Sequence number of the last packet received from link testing mote (unsigned integer)
LPPS uint32 `json:"lpps"` // Number of lost PPS pulses (unsigned integer)
Temp int32 `json:"temp"` // Temperature of the Gateway (signed integer)
FPGA uint32 `json:"fpga"` // Version of Gateway FPGA (unsigned integer)
DSP uint32 `json:"dsp"` // Version of Gateway DSP software (unsigned interger)
HAL string `json:"hal"` // Version of Gateway driver (format X.X.X)
// Informal fields
Pfrm string `json:"pfrm"` // Platform definition
Mail string `json:"mail"` // Email address of gateway operator
Desc string `json:"desc"` // Public description of this device
}
// TXPK contains a RF packet to be emitted and associated metadata.
type TXPK struct {
Imme bool `json:"imme"` // Send packet immediately (will ignore tmst & time)
Tmst uint32 `json:"tmst,omitempty"` // Send packet on a certain timestamp value (will ignore time)
Time *CompactTime `json:"time,omitempty"` // Send packet at a certain time (GPS synchronization required)
Freq float64 `json:"freq"` // TX central frequency in MHz (unsigned float, Hz precision)
RFCh uint8 `json:"rfch"` // Concentrator "RF chain" used for TX (unsigned integer)
Powe uint8 `json:"powe"` // TX output power in dBm (unsigned integer, dBm precision)
Modu string `json:"modu"` // Modulation identifier "LORA" or "FSK"
DatR DatR `json:"datr"` // LoRa datarate identifier (eg. SF12BW500) || FSK datarate (unsigned, in bits per second)
CodR string `json:"codr,omitempty"` // LoRa ECC coding rate identifier
FDev uint16 `json:"fdev,omitempty"` // FSK frequency deviation (unsigned integer, in Hz)
IPol bool `json:"ipol"` // Lora modulation polarization inversion
Prea uint16 `json:"prea,omitempty"` // RF preamble size (unsigned integer)
Size uint16 `json:"size"` // RF packet payload size in bytes (unsigned integer)
NCRC bool `json:"ncrc,omitempty"` // If true, disable the CRC of the physical layer (optional)
Data string `json:"data"` // Base64 encoded RF packet payload, padding optional
}
// GetPacketType returns the packet type for the given packet data.
func GetPacketType(data []byte) (PacketType, error) {
if len(data) < 4 {
return PacketType(0), errors.New("gateway: at least 4 bytes of data are expected")
}
if !protocolSupported(data[0]) {
return PacketType(0), ErrInvalidProtocolVersion
}
return PacketType(data[3]), nil
}
